Skip to content

Instantly share code, notes, and snippets.

@carllerche
Created March 28, 2011 16:14
Show Gist options
  • Save carllerche/890740 to your computer and use it in GitHub Desktop.
Save carllerche/890740 to your computer and use it in GitHub Desktop.
#0 get_object (state=<value optimized out>, call_frame=<value optimized out>, msg=<value optimized out>, args=<value optimized out>)
at vm/builtin/nativemethod.hpp:81
#1 invoke (state=<value optimized out>, call_frame=<value optimized out>, msg=<value optimized out>, args=<value optimized out>)
at vm/builtin/nativemethod.cpp:241
#2 rubinius::NativeMethod::executor_implementation<rubinius::OneArgument> (state=<value optimized out>, call_frame=<value optimized out>,
msg=<value optimized out>, args=<value optimized out>) at vm/builtin/nativemethod.cpp:659
#3 0x000000000055b48f in execute (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ffb3d0) at vm/inline_cache.hpp:194
#4 rubinius::VMMethod::interpreter (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ffb3d0) at ./vm/gen/instruction_implementations.hpp:526
#5 0x0000000000618157 in rubinius::Object* rubinius::VMMethod::execute_specialized<rubinius::OneArgument>(rubinius::VM*, rubinius::CallFrame*, rubinius::Dispatch&, rubinius::Arguments&) ()
#6 0x000000000062286d in rubinius::CompiledMethod::default_executor (state=0x10841e0, call_frame=0x7fffffffb7e0, msg=..., args=...)
at vm/builtin/compiledmethod.cpp:156
#7 0x000000000055b48f in execute (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ffb7e0) at vm/inline_cache.hpp:194
#8 rubinius::VMMethod::interpreter (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ffb7e0) at ./vm/gen/instruction_implementations.hpp:526
#9 0x0000000000616cbc in rubinius::Object* rubinius::VMMethod::execute_specialized<rubinius::NoArguments>(rubinius::VM*, rubinius::CallFrame*, rubinius::Dispatch&, rubinius::Arguments&) ()
#10 0x000000000062286d in rubinius::CompiledMethod::default_executor (state=0x10841e0, call_frame=0x7fffffffbcb0, msg=..., args=...)
at vm/builtin/compiledmethod.cpp:156
#11 0x000000000064190c in rubinius::Object::send_prim (this=0x7ffff6768ab8, state=0x10841e0, exec=<value optimized out>, call_frame=0x7fffffffbcb0,
msg=<value optimized out>, args=...) at vm/builtin/object.cpp:525
#12 0x00000000005b9073 in rubinius::Primitives::object_send (state=0x10841e0, call_frame=0x7fffffffbcb0, msg=..., args=...)
at vm/gen/primitives_glue.gen.cpp:21276
#13 0x000000000055b48f in execute (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ffbcb0) at vm/inline_cache.hpp:194
#14 rubinius::VMMethod::interpreter (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ffbcb0) at ./vm/gen/instruction_implementations.hpp:526
#15 0x0000000000618157 in rubinius::Object* rubinius::VMMethod::execute_specialized<rubinius::OneArgument>(rubinius::VM*, rubinius::CallFrame*, rubinius::Dispatch&, rubinius::Arguments&) ()
#16 0x000000000062286d in rubinius::CompiledMethod::default_executor (state=0x10841e0, call_frame=0x7fffffffc0c0, msg=..., args=...)
at vm/builtin/compiledmethod.cpp:156
#17 0x000000000055b48f in execute (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ffc0c0) at vm/inline_cache.hpp:194
#18 rubinius::VMMethod::interpreter (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ffc0c0) at ./vm/gen/instruction_implementations.hpp:526
#19 0x0000000000617093 in rubinius::Object* rubinius::VMMethod::execute_specialized<rubinius::GenericArguments>(rubinius::VM*, rubinius::CallFrame*, rubinius::Dispatch&, rubinius::Arguments&) ()
#20 0x000000000062286d in rubinius::CompiledMethod::default_executor (state=0x10841e0, call_frame=0x7fffffffc520, msg=..., args=...)
at vm/builtin/compiledmethod.cpp:156
#21 0x000000000055b48f in execute (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ffc520) at vm/inline_cache.hpp:194
#22 rubinius::VMMethod::interpreter (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ffc520) at ./vm/gen/instruction_implementations.hpp:526
#23 0x0000000000616cbc in rubinius::Object* rubinius::VMMethod::execute_specialized<rubinius::NoArguments>(rubinius::VM*, rubinius::CallFrame*, rubinius::Dispatch&, rubinius::Arguments&) ()
#24 0x000000000062286d in rubinius::CompiledMethod::default_executor (state=0x10841e0, call_frame=0x7fffffffc950, msg=..., args=...)
at vm/builtin/compiledmethod.cpp:156
#25 0x000000000055b3cb in execute (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ffc950) at vm/inline_cache.hpp:194
#26 rubinius::VMMethod::interpreter (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ffc950) at ./vm/gen/instruction_implementations.hpp:507
#27 0x0000000000616cbc in rubinius::Object* rubinius::VMMethod::execute_specialized<rubinius::NoArguments>(rubinius::VM*, rubinius::CallFrame*, rubinius::Dispatch&, rubinius::Arguments&) ()
#28 0x000000000062286d in rubinius::CompiledMethod::default_executor (state=0x10841e0, call_frame=0x7fffffffcd90, msg=..., args=...)
at vm/builtin/compiledmethod.cpp:156
#29 0x000000000055b48f in execute (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ffcd90) at vm/inline_cache.hpp:194
#30 rubinius::VMMethod::interpreter (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ffcd90) at ./vm/gen/instruction_implementations.hpp:526
#31 0x0000000000616cbc in rubinius::Object* rubinius::VMMethod::execute_specialized<rubinius::NoArguments>(rubinius::VM*, rubinius::CallFrame*, rubinius::Dispatch&, rubinius::Arguments&) ()
#32 0x000000000062286d in rubinius::CompiledMethod::default_executor (state=0x10841e0, call_frame=0x7fffffffd1d0, msg=..., args=...)
at vm/builtin/compiledmethod.cpp:156
#33 0x000000000055b48f in execute (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ffd1d0) at vm/inline_cache.hpp:194
#34 rubinius::VMMethod::interpreter (state=0x10841e0, vmm=<value optimized out>, call_frame=0x7fffffffd1d0) at ./vm/gen/instruction_implementations.hpp:526
#35 0x0000000000616cbc in rubinius::Object* rubinius::VMMethod::execute_specialized<rubinius::NoArguments>(rubinius::VM*, rubinius::CallFrame*, rubinius::Dispatch&, rubinius::Arguments&) ()
#36 0x000000000062286d in rubinius::CompiledMethod::default_executor (state=0x10841e0, call_frame=0x0, msg=..., args=...)
at vm/builtin/compiledmethod.cpp:156
#37 0x0000000000547fc4 in rubinius::CompiledFile::execute (this=<value optimized out>, state=0x10841e0) at vm/compiled_file.cpp:51
#38 0x000000000054b79d in rubinius::Environment::run_file (this=0x7fffffffd8d0, file=DWARF-2 expression error: DW_OP_reg operations must be used either alone or in conjuction with DW_OP_piece or DW_OP_bit_piece.
) at vm/environment.cpp:451
#39 0x000000000054d706 in rubinius::Environment::run_from_filesystem (this=0x7fffffffd8d0, root=DWARF-2 expression error: DW_OP_reg operations must be used either alone or in conjuction with DW_OP_piece or DW_OP_bit_piece.
) at vm/environment.cpp:597
#40 0x000000000069336e in main (argc=<value optimized out>, argv=<value optimized out>) at vm/drivers/cli.cpp:50
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ment